The United States political landscape keeps getting heated amid the Kamala Harris and Donald Trump faceoff as the election draws closer. Ever since Vice President Harris officially joined the race as Democratic National Committee (DNC) nominee, she has received a mix of support and disapproval. Mike Novogratz recently made a statement that suggests he supports her.

Advertisement

Mike Novogratz Hints at Support For Harris

Galaxy Digital CEO Mike Novogratz gave an idea of what United States voters want in this current election cycle during a podcast. He made it clear that Americans yearn for younger leaders as they are tired of the old politicians. Novogratz described “old politicians” as those who are around 80 years of age, citing precisely that 83% of Americans are done with them.

This percentage is quite high and very rare according to Novogratz. Currently, there are four candidates competing for the position of the 47th United States president. Recent DNC nominee Kamala Harris is 59 years old. Republican presidential candidate Donald Trump is 78-year-old while Libertarian candidate Chase Oliver is 38 years old. Finally, Independent candidate Robert F. Kennedy Jr. is 70-years old.

It is quite obvious that Trump is the oldest of the four and is likely the target of Novogratz statement. In addition, Novogratz made it clear that he is watching out for Kamala Harris.

“We’re gonna know who Kamala Harris is and how she’s gonna run in the next eight weeks,” Galaxy Digital CEO said, adding that he would withhold his judgement until that time. Still, he believes that she has the capacity to win the election.

For or Against Kamala Harris?

Mike Novogratz is yet to outrightly declare his support for Kamala Harris but his statements precedes him. A few days ago, he took it upon himself to advise the DNC nominee about strongly standing against Senator Elizabeth Warren’s anti-crypto position. At this pace, his endorsement is likely to come soon, probably in eight weeks time like he mentioned.

One of Kamala Harris’s current critic is Peter Schiff, the notorious anti-Bitcoin financial investor. With the United States stock market facing a downtrend, Schiff believes that the presidential candidate has a part to play in it.

In the meantime, Kamala Harris is trying to adopt a crypto policy but her effort is meeting with obstructions.
